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Lesson timer #6062

Open
ctdealba opened this issue Oct 31, 2022 · 6 comments
Open

Lesson timer #6062

ctdealba opened this issue Oct 31, 2022 · 6 comments
Labels
Customer Report Issues or PRs that were reported via Happiness. Previously known as "Happiness Request". [Type] Enhancement

Comments

@ctdealba
Copy link

Reported in here: 5626752 - zen

Add the same quiz timer but for lessons.

@ricsmo
Copy link

ricsmo commented Nov 1, 2022

#6045 I'd appreciate this.

@yscik
Copy link
Contributor

yscik commented Nov 9, 2022

Noting that this would be a minimum time spent on the lesson, not a maximum like the quiz.

I think as the simplest approach we can add the countdown to or near the Complete lesson button, similar to the indicator for required blocks in the lesson, along with a Lesson Timer option in the lesson settings panel in the editor.

@ricsmo
Copy link

ricsmo commented Nov 10, 2022

To perhaps help accelerate idea generation, the plugin I referred to above does it all through JavaScript. PHP generates a script block with the variables, etc. that the JS that loads on page load reads from and it basically hides the complete lesson button and adds a timer instead until the timer counts down. It also uses the existing lesson time from Sensei, but it would be nice if that didn't have to be in whole minutes (not sure if it's still that way, but it was back when I first started using that plugin and haven't had to ever go back and change the times).

@StefMattana
Copy link

+1 in 6339000-zen:

The state rules governing my business require a minimum amount of time spent on each lesson. How can I lock each lesson until those required minutes pass?

@github-actions
Copy link

github-actions bot commented Jun 1, 2023

Support References

This comment is automatically generated. Please do not edit it.

  • 6339000-zen
  • 8675554-zen

@dericleeyy
Copy link

8675554-zen requesting for a minimum time requirement spent on a lesson before it can be completed.

@github-actions github-actions bot added the Customer Report Issues or PRs that were reported via Happiness. Previously known as "Happiness Request". label Sep 3, 2024
@donnapep donnapep removed the [Status] Needs Triage Issue needs to be triaged label Sep 3,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Customer Report Issues or PRs that were reported via Happiness. Previously known as "Happiness Request". [Type] Enhancement
Projects
None yet
Development

No branches or pull requests

6 participants